Fungal diseases
Powdery mildew is a common fungal disease affecting a wide range of plants, caused by various species of fungi within the order Erysiphales. These fungi are obligate parasites, meaning they must live on a host plant to survive, extracting nutrients via specialized structures called haustoria that penetrate the epidermal cells.

Fungal diseases
The disease attacks a vast array of crops, including cereals, vegetables, fruit trees, and ornamental plants. Crops like cucumbers, grapes, roses, and apples are particularly susceptible, making powdery mildew one of the most frequently encountered challenges in both commercial agriculture and home gardening.
The most recognizable symptom is the development of a white or grayish, powdery-looking fungal growth on the surface of leaves, stems, and flowers. As the infection progresses, the powdery spots expand and merge. Heavily infested tissues may become yellowed, distorted, stunted, or develop necrotic spots, eventually leading to leaf drop.
The fungus thrives in conditions of high humidity (without direct moisture on leaves) and moderate temperatures, typically between 18°C and 25°C. Poor air circulation caused by overcrowding, as well as excessive nitrogen fertilization which promotes lush but tender new growth, significantly increase the plant's susceptibility to the pathogen.
The economic impact of powdery mildew is severe, as the disease reduces the plant's photosynthetic capacity, leading to reduced vigor and diminished crop yields. In commercial fruit and vegetable production, the cosmetic damage caused by the fungus often renders the produce unmarketable, leading to substantial financial losses.
Effective management and prevention strategies include:
- Selecting plant varieties with documented resistance to powdery mildew.
- Maintaining proper spacing between plants to improve airflow and reduce humidity around the foliage.
- Pruning and removing infected plant parts to limit the source of inoculum.
- Applying a balanced fertilizer regime to avoid excessive nitrogen stimulation.
- Using preventative or curative fungicides, such as sulfur-based products, potassium bicarbonate, or systemic triazoles.
